The Future of Work: How AI Will Change Business Leadership
The AI revolution is rapidly transforming how organizations operate, placing new demands on business leaders. As AI tools automate routine tasks and generate insights at scale, leadership must evolve from traditional oversight to strategic orchestration of human and machine capabilities.
AI-Driven Shifts in Decision-Making
Leaders now rely on AI for real-time data analysis, predictive modeling, and scenario planning. This shift frees executives to focus on vision and creativity rather than number-crunching.
- Faster, evidence-based choices: AI surfaces patterns humans might miss.
- Risk reduction: Algorithms flag potential issues before they escalate.
- Personalized strategies: Tailored recommendations improve customer and employee outcomes.
Essential New Leadership Skills
Tomorrow's leaders will need a blend of technical literacy and human-centric abilities.
- Mastering AI ethics and governance
- Fostering continuous learning cultures
- Building trust in hybrid human-AI teams
- Communicating complex insights clearly
Challenges and Opportunities Ahead
While AI promises efficiency gains, it also raises concerns around job displacement, bias, and data privacy. Forward-thinking organizations are investing in upskilling programs and transparent AI policies to turn these challenges into competitive advantages.
Embracing this transformation positions leaders to build resilient, innovative enterprises ready for the next decade of work.
